The New England Patriots were the surprise of the 2025 season, riding the consistency of quarterback Drake Maye and a stingy defense to a 14-3 record in the regular season and a run to the Super Bowl following back-to-back 4-13 finishes.
The rare tight end prospect with size (6-6, 245 pounds), speed (4.62-second 40-yard dash), production (32 catches for 482 yards in 2025) and blocking skills, Raridon is a mid-round prospect because he tore the same ACL in 2021, while still in high school, and 2022. The Patriots need to develop a tight end behind Hunter Henry and Julian Hill.
Speaking to reporters earlier this week, New England Patriots executive vice president of player personnel Eliot Wolf gave some insight into the state of the linebacker class in this year’s NFL Draft. While he didn’t sound overly excited about the group, he did point out that there would be plenty of talent in the late-round range.
